Archaeological excavations in Van unveil child skeleton with two dragon head bracelets
20.08.2020

VAN, TURKEY - AUGUST 20 : Close-up of one of the two dragon head bracelets on a child's skeleton found in archaeological excavations at Castle of Cavustepe in Gurpinar district of Turkey's eastern Van province on August 20, 2020. Works continue at the 2,750 year-old Necropolis, unveiled in the excavations and restoration works three years ago, where aristocrats are believed to be buried. A child skeleton was found wearing dragon head braceletes on each biceps and accessories around the neck. ( Mesut Varol - Anadolu Agency )
